When you arrive here, I fear
You’ll have to suspend your ideals
I am more than my words
As well as much less
Alas

Can you pack away
Most of your doubt
And leave it behind?

The bit that remains
We can mix with my own
Cast it into the wind
That blows by this shack

Watch it drift down the river

Let it float out of sight

The small hope that we have
For a future together
We can sow with the lilies
That will grow in the spring

Your ticket will be there

Will you be on the plane?

To watch the drift?
To grow the lilies?

Je t'aime
Ed...
